Title of article :
A logic for a coordination model with multiple spaces
Author/Authors :
P. Ciancarini، نويسنده , , Rina M. Mazza، نويسنده , , L. Pazzaglia، نويسنده ,
Issue Information :
ماهنامه با شماره پیاپی سال 1998
Pages :
31
From page :
231
To page :
261
Abstract :
This paper introduces and studies PoliS, a coordination model to specify the software architecture of distributed applications. PoliS is based on multiple dataspaces containing both data and programs. We define PoliS syntax and semantics, and show how it can be used as a formal notation for specifying open systems. We adopt TLA logic to reason on PoliS specifications. Finally, we discuss an application field for PoliS, namely we use it to specify and reason on software architectures of some simple distributed systems.
Keywords :
Distributed programming , TLA , PoliS , Larch prover , Software architectures , Coordination model , Tuple space
Journal title :
Science of Computer Programming
Serial Year :
1998
Journal title :
Science of Computer Programming
Record number :
1079510
Link To Document :
بازگشت